Please avoid using the appliance in any place where it would be subjected to high temperatures, low
temperatures, physical shocks or vibration. The appliance is designed to be operated and stored in a situation
where temperatures are between +5° and +40° Celsius. Do not use the appliance in a wet or humid
environment.

If your appliance is damaged or operates in an abnormal way, immediately stop using it and take it to an
authorised service engineer for checking, repair or adjustment.

The manufacturer is not liable for damage resulting from excessive use, inappropriate handling, inadequate
maintenance, failure to follow guidance in the instruction manual or wear and tear from regular use. In
addition, the manufacturer is not liable for damage resulting from any part of the appliance being broken or
cracked.

Warning! Never leave the mincer unattended when it’s switched on. Always switch the appliance off and
unplug it from the mains socket when you’ve finished using it or want to take a break.

In order to avoid electric shock, never immerse the appliance in water or any other liquid. Never touch the
appliance with wet hands. Never allow the wall socket to become wet. You must have dry hands when
you plug the mains connector into the wall socket and when you unplug it. If any moisture gets inside the
appliance, immediately stop using it and take it to a service engineer for checking or repair.

After use and before cleaning, always disconnect the appliance from the mains. Never do this by pulling
on the cable; always take hold of the plug and pull out of the socket. Switch off the appliance before
disconnecting it from the mains.

Never lay the mains cable beside or across sharp edges or hot surfaces. Never wrap the mains cable around
the cover of the appliance, do not pull the cable and do not lift the appliance with the mains cable because
the cable can break or the insulation can be damaged. A damaged cable must be replaced by an authorised
service engineer. The appliance must not be used or connected to a wall socket if the cable is damaged.

Do not touch the appliance with moist hands. Plug the connector of the appliance into the mains with dry
hands only, and check that the casing, power cord and connector of the appliance as well as the mains socket
are dry. Should any moisture get inside the casing of the appliance stop using it immediately and take it to a
specialized service for checking or repair.

Only use the appliance on a stable, level surface. Keep it away from water and make sure it cannot
accidentally slip or fall. If the appliance comes into contact with any kind of moisture or liquid during use,
immediately unplug it from the mains. Do not touch it or attempt to take it out of the liquid until the mains
plug has been removed from the socket. You must not use the appliance again before having it checked and
repaired by a specialist engineer.

Do not lengthen or alter the mains cable of the appliance. If you need a longer cable between the appliance
and the wall socket, you should buy a standard extension cord from an electrical dealer. When using an
extension cord, be careful not to create a hazard that you or someone else could trip over.

Never use the appliance with its power cable damaged, if operation is erratic or it is otherwise damaged.
In these cases take the appliance to an authorised service engineer for checking, repair or adjustment. Only
skilled experts in the service station are authorised to repair the appliance.
